Ritual of Simplicity (Excerpts from the Book: The Monk Who Sold His Ferrari)


This ritual requires you to live a simple life.One must never live in the thick of thin things. Focus only on your priorities,those activities which are truly meaningful.Your life will be uncluttered, rewarding and exceptionally peaceful.


Living simply means reducing your needs:stop wearing expensive clothes, you do not have to read six news papers a day,stop needing to be available to everyone all the time, eat less, maybe become a vegetarian.Stop picking up the phone every time it rings.Stop wasting time reading junk mail, spend more time with your kids, cut on the club membership,and reduce eating out every now and then, simple things that clutter our lives.

Lifelong happiness does come through striving to realize your dreams. You are at your best when you are moving forward.The key is not to make your happiness contingent on finding that elusive pot of gold at the end of the rainbow rather enjoying the journey while at it.
